Daily Duties at Premier Exhibitions:
-Cold call ticket sales -Manage over 100 relationships with exhibit ticket vendors including national brokers, time shares, concierge and non-traditional sales avenues -Manage box office handling of exhibition sales -Buy all advertising media -Create trade relationships and third party promotions -Conceptualize and execute special media and publicity events -Coordinate efforts between in-house publicity, hotel/casino publicity and outside publicity agencies -Manage box office transition between two major Las Vegas casinos
